Alert: Hollowpine incremental static site rebuilds have exceeded the expected change-set size threshold. This fires when a rebuild touches more than 40% of pages, which may indicate cache poisoning, a compromised content source, or an upstream template injection rather than a legitimate bulk edit. Review the triggering commit range and confirm the author identity before acknowledging. Triage steps and the security review checklist for this alert are maintained on the internal page below.

wiki page, tahaf-tajog: https://jira.ordindyn.corp/pipeline

## Runbook — Bellthorpe timetable solver

Solver runs nightly after enrollment close. If it exceeds the 20-minute budget, it emits a partial schedule flagged draft; do not publish drafts. Constraint weights are versioned with the repo — any change needs review sign-off. Restarts are safe; state is rebuilt from the enrollment snapshot. The solver starts with the configuration below.

settings of kajep-kajop:
OLIDOR_LOG_LEVEL=info
OLIDOR_METRICS_HOST=metrics.olidor.norvacorp.corp
OLIDOR_POOL_SIZE=4

Vendor note for security review: mobile deep-link routing for the Larkspur app is handled by Trailgate, a third-party SDK from Ostrel Systems. Scope: link resolution, deferred attribution, fallback web routing. Data shared: device model, app version, hashed install token. No payment or credential data transits the SDK. Contract renewed last quarter; pen test report on file. Open item: wildcard domain claims need tightening before next release. Questions on the vendor's handling practices go to their security liaison at the inbox below.

billing contact of kagaf-bahif = fraox_ralvan_tamwyn@zemvarcloud.local

**Q: How do I perform bulk edits in the Tallyworks admin table?**

Select rows with the checkbox column, then choose an action from the batch menu. Edits over 500 rows require elevated mode, which locks the table for other admins until you commit. Elevated mode prompts for the maintainer recovery passphrase, which is kept on record directly below this entry.

unlock words, fafop-hawep: briwyn-oliix-sorox